Step 1
Preheat oven to 350F.
Step 2
In a small bowl, stir together the butter and sugar until well combined. Add in the vanilla and egg stir until incorporated.
Step 3
Sprinkle the the salt, baking powder, and baking soda evenly over the mixture and stir until incorporated. Add the flour and stir just until combined. Fold in the 1/4 cup chocolate chips.
Step 4
Form a large ball of dough in the center of a baking sheet lined with parchment paper or a silpat. Top with more chocolate chips and a bit of salt if desired.
Step 5
Bake at 350F for 13-15 minutes until the edges are set and lightly browned and the center still looks under-baked.
Step 6
Allow to cool for several minutes on the baking sheet.
